Bengali
Languages
English
Bengali
French
German
Japanese
Korean
Portuguese
Spanish
Tamil

qiskit.opflow.gradients.Hessian.get_hessian

Hessian.get_hessian(operator, params=None)[source]

Get the Hessian for the given operator w.r.t. the given parameters

প্যারামিটার
রিটার্নস

Operator which represents the gradient w.r.t. the given params.

রেইজেস
  • ValueError -- If params contains a parameter not present in operator.

  • ValueError -- If operator is not parameterized.

  • OpflowError -- If the coefficient of the operator could not be reduced to 1.

  • OpflowError -- If the differentiation of a combo_fn requires JAX but the package is not installed.

  • TypeError -- If the operator does not include a StateFn given by a quantum circuit

  • TypeError -- If the parameters were given in an unsupported format.

  • Exception -- Unintended code is reached

  • MissingOptionalLibraryError -- jax not installed

রিটার্ন টাইপ

OperatorBase